Energy Storage: The key to energy access in East Africa

In East Africa, pumped hydro dams are usually the main source of energy storage. In essence, a scan across most countries in the region shows that reliance on hydroelectricity is significant. Lately, other sources of generation, namely wind and solar, are starting to be built

What are South Africa's peaking power stations?

South Africa’s peaking power stations are hydroelectric, hydro pumped storage and gas turbine stations. Peaking Generation consist of stations that operate during peak periods or when the system is constrained, which is when demand is higher than what your base-load can supply at the time.

Where is South Africa's only nuclear power station?

Koeberg Nuclear Power Station, situated near Cape Town, is South Africa’s only nuclear power facility. It has two reactors, generating about 1,800 MW of electricity, which constitutes a significant portion of the country’s energy mix. The reliability and efficiency of nuclear energy help stabilize the grid during periods of high demand. 3.

What is the importance of hydro pumped storage in KwaZulu-Natal?

Drakensberg Power Station: This hydro pumped storage facility is essential for balancing the grid, utilizing stored water to generate electricity during peak demand. Ingula Pumped Storage Scheme: Situated between KwaZulu-Natal and the Free State, Ingula is vital for energy storage, allowing Eskom to generate power quickly when needed.

How many peaking power stations are there?

There are fourteen peaking power stations: gas turbine stations, hydroelectric (run-of-river), hydro pumped storage and wind with a total nominal capacity of 5 894.4MW’s. Peaking Generation has three visitors centres in the group:
